Can I Freeze Tripe?

January 24, 2024 by Sophia Kim

Can I Freeze Tripe? It is perfectly safe to freeze raw or cooked tripe. These products are safe in the freezer indefinitely, but will be best quality in the freezer for 3-4 months. Can I Feed My Dog Only Green Tripe?

January 24, 2024 by Sophia Kim

Can I Feed My Dog Only Green Tripe? Raw green tripe is lower in fat, is an excellent source of protein and has a calcium to phosphorous ratio of 1:1, which is perfect for dogs! Does Tripe Have Health Benefits?

January 24, 2024 by Sophia Kim

Does Tripe Have Health Benefits? Like most organ meats, tripe is extremely nutritious and provides benefits to your health. In addition to being a good source of protein, tripe is rich in B vitamins and minerals, including calcium, iron, magnesium, phosphorus, zinc, manganese and selenium.
